Learning Outcomes of the Course Unit
The course focuses on processes that evaluate the environmental and economic efficiency of spatial and spatial planning tools as well as potential gains from political reforms.
Individual elements are analyzed and evaluated - relationships between land use patterns are explored. Relationships to socio-economic outcomes. Pressures on the environment in relation to political instruments. The subject is aimed predominantly on the urbanized area, but the landscape is marginally solved in the study.
